Abstract

<PICT:0593899/III/1> <PICT:0593899/III/2> The liquid cleansing mixture for cleaning metal parts, according to the parent Specification, comprising an unstable mixture of an emulsion of water and a grease solvent and an unemulsified excess of another or the same grease solvent, is modified in that the emulsion is in an acid condition and preferably has a pH falling within 2.0 to 3.5. The acidity inhibits the tendency of the free solvent emulsifying and forming a stable emulsion by means of the soil, containing emulsifying agents, being removed from the metal parts. The solvents specified comprise kerosene, naphtha, or mineral spirit of intermediate volatility thereto; the preferred emulsifying agent is oleic acid amine soap; other additions may comprise pine oil, and blending agents such as "butyl cellosolve," "cyclohexanol." The above may be compounded to form solutions ready for admixture with the water and acidifiers. The latter may comprise sulphuric, phosphoric, pyrophosphoric, phosphorous, oxalic, maleic, chlor and brom-acetic acids and phthalic acid, and also alkali bisulphates and aluminium sulphate. The preferred method is to spray the parts with the cleansing mixture. Metals which may be etched with the material are preferably dipped in solvent or in the above emulsion preferably unacidified or in the latter underlying the solvent layer and then withdrawn and subjected to the spray cleaning, a film of solvent &c. protecting the metal by this preliminary. In a preferred plant for effecting the spray cleaning comprising a spraying compartment 25 and rinsing compartments 26, 27 through which the metal parts to be cleaned are conveyed, passing through openings in the side walls thereof, the cleansing mixture is supplied to apertured vertical pipes 32 arranged along the rear and front walls of the spraying compartment by means of a pump 38 which withdraws a mixture of the emulsion and solvent from a reservoir below the spraying compartment, the cleansing mixture falling into the reservoir after the spraying operation. The open end of the pump intake pipe 45 lies just below the interface 43 of the stratified solvent and emulsion layers in the reservoir. Similar arrangements of spray pipes, pumps, and rinse water reservoirs are provided with the rinsing compartments 26, 27.
